ES House seems to be a fraudulent online store due to the following reasons:-

# ESHouse has provided its company's address as 1350 Boulevard Le Corbusier Laval, Quebec H7N 0A9 where we don't find any shop or company or store with name ES House. Instead, we find out businesses with name Centre Hi-Fi and Tim Hortons on that address (Sources: Yelp.ca and Google Maps). So, we don't think the provided company's address is real.

# Like lots of scam sites, the website ESHouse has also lots of drawbacks. For example;

  • It has designed its website roughly such as SHOP NOW buttons on the home page are not working.
  • It is offering a discount on the price of lots of products which is quite low compared with the current market rate. Such a low price are mostly found to be offered by scam sites.
  • Lots of details provided on the ESHouse website match with multiple scam sites such as its Refund Policy where it has mentioned: "You will be responsible for paying for your own shipping costs for returning your item. Shipping costs are non-refundable."; "Only regular priced items may be refunded, unfortunately sale items cannot be refunded" and so on. However, like we said before, ESHouse is selling lots of items on sale by providing a discount. So, it is clear that ESHouse is not a refund friendly online store. Actually, lots of scam sites are using exactly the same Refund Policy.
  • ESHouse hasn’t secured its website properly with security services like Norton or McAfee and so on. Since the ESHouse website is not secured properly, so if you shop at this site, your personal and financial information might be stolen.
  • You can find lots of complaints from ESHouse users about their card getting declined while they tried to make purchase at ESHouse. Previously, lots of scam sites have done that to steal the credit card information of the users.
